In comprehending asthma, it is very important to recognize that it is a persistent breathing problem that affects countless people worldwide. It causes inflammation and constricting of the airways, bring about breathing difficulties. While there is no treatment for asthma, reliable asthma management methods can assist people lead regular, active lives. Asthma Signs and symptoms
Asthma signs differ from one person to another and can vary from light to serious. Usual symptoms consist of:
Shortness of breath
Wheezing
Coughing, specifically at night or morning
Breast tightness or pain
Boosted mucus production
Serious asthma strikes can be deadly, requiring prompt clinical focus. Comprehending early indication can help stop problems.
Asthma Medical diagnosis
A correct asthma medical diagnosis is critical for efficient therapy. Medical professionals utilize several methods to detect asthma, consisting of:
Case history and symptom evaluation
Lung function tests such as spirometry
Peak circulation measurements to examine airflow
Allergic reaction screening to determine triggers
If asthma is suspected, a specialist may conduct additional examinations to dismiss various other respiratory system conditions.
Asthma Activates
Recognizing and staying clear of asthma sets off is necessary for handling symptoms. Common triggers consist of:
Allergens (pollen, pet dander, allergen, mold and mildew).
Air pollution and smoke.
Cold air or weather condition adjustments.
Workout and exertion.
Respiratory infections (colds, flu, sinus infections).
Solid smells and chemical fumes.
Recognizing personal triggers and producing an asthma care strategy can significantly lower flare-ups.
Asthma Therapy Options.
Asthma therapy focuses on controlling signs and stopping attacks. The key therapies include:.
1. Asthma Inhalers.
Asthma inhalers are the most typical treatment, providing drug straight to the lungs. They include:.
Reducer inhalers (short-acting bronchodilators) for immediate signs and symptom relief.
Preventer inhalers (steroids) to minimize swelling and stop attacks.
Mix inhalers for lasting control.
2. Asthma Medicines.
In addition to inhalers, doctors may suggest:.
Dental corticosteroids for severe asthma.
Leukotriene modifiers to decrease respiratory tract swelling.
Biologic therapies for people with serious asthma that do not respond to typical therapies.
Asthma and Allergic reactions.
There is a solid web link between asthma and allergies. Sensitive asthma is activated by allergens such as pollen, mold, or family pet dander. Managing allergic reactions via drug, staying clear of allergens, and making use of air purifiers can help in reducing asthma signs.

Childhood Asthma.
Youth asthma is a considerable issue as it affects a kid's every day life and tasks. Symptoms in kids consist of constant coughing, trouble sleeping because of wheezing, and shortness of breath. Early diagnosis and monitoring assistance improve quality of life.
Asthma and Exercise.
Exercise is useful for general health and wellness, but it can be testing for those with exercise-induced bronchoconstriction (EIB). To stay active safely:.
Heat up before exercising.
Select low-intensity tasks like swimming or walking.
Use a recommended inhaler prior to exercise.
Avoid exercising in extreme weather conditions.
Extreme Asthma and When to See an Asthma Specialist.
Severe asthma does not respond well to typical therapies and calls for specialized treatment. An asthma expert can establish a tailored therapy strategy, including advanced drugs or biologic therapy.
